ABSTRACT

To undertake any serious study we must consider the importance of research and the issue of identifying and gaining access to the relevant source material that will underpin this research. Using reference material from a range of sources can be of great benefit to artists and designers of all kinds. Animators who want to analyze action can gain a great deal from such material. Unlike animation’s pioneers, who had little access to the kind of research material that makes action analysis possible, we are in the very fortunate position of having a wealth of material on which to draw.
